How to Diagnose and Repair UPVC Door Issues
Upvc doors are a popular choice in modern buildings because of their energy efficiency and durability. However, like any fixture they are susceptible to issues that require repairs to ensure their functionality.
Plastic filler with a low shrinkage can be used to repair small cracks. In the same way, hinges that are misaligned can be re-aligned to restore their proper function.

To repair a scuff in a uPVC window or door, the first step is to clean the surface. With isopropyl Alcohol, clean any dirt or debris from the surface. Then apply a damp microfibre cloth and apply two small drops of car polish or furniture polish. Rub the scuff lightly using the same direction as uPVC. Allow the scuffs to dry for at least 20 minutes before buffing them again.
Another popular uPVC repair involves filling a crack in the door or window. A uPVC kit is made up of acrylic that is easy to apply to the crack. It is recommended that the patch of compound should be put on within two minutes of mixing it, as this will make it easier to work with. Once the patch has been applied, it can be sanded down to ensure that it blends seamlessly with the rest of the uPVC.

If your uPVC door isn't locking properly It's likely that the barrel part of the lock has become faulty. You can test this by trying to turn the handle. If the handle is loose or floppy, you can tighten it by using the screws that are inserted into the barrel. This should resolve the issue.
Another common uPVC door problem is a broken gearbox. You can diagnose this by turning the handle and hearing a click when the key is inserted into the barrel. This is typically caused by dust and dirt that have accumulated over time. In this instance the solution is to clean the lock.

Hinges that are not aligned
Over time the hinges of uPVC may loosen. This could cause the door to slide and put pressure on the locking mechanisms. The good news is that it is a relatively simple issue to solve. You will first need to determine which hinge needs adjustment. This is typically done by looking for an adjustment screw on each of the hinges. They are usually located on the top and bottom of the hinges. A Phillips screwdriver will be needed to loosen the screw. Once the screw is loose, it can then be turned to move the hinge in the right direction. After you have made the necessary adjustments, make sure that you tighten the screw.
Repeat this procedure for all hinges on the uPVC doors. You will need to test your door once you have made sure that all hinges have been properly adjusted. Verify that the lock is working properly and that the door opens and closes smoothly. You should also make sure that the door doesn't get caught on the floor or create draughts.
The hinges on uPVC doorways can become out of alignment for a variety of reasons. Some of these include; improper installation, changes in weather and the natural settling of a home or building. If your uPVC doors aren't in alignment it can cause problems with the multipoint lock mechanism making it difficult to open and close the door.
There are different methods to adjust hinges based on the kind you have. There will be slots or slots for vertical and/or lateral adjustment on butt hinges. These are commonly used on modern uPVC door models and let you fine tune the door's movement.
Another kind of hinge for uPVC doors is called a flag hinge. They typically include one or more adjustment screws that can be used to adjust the height of the door. They are typically located at the top or bottom hinge. They can be adjusted by turning the screw clockwise or anti-clockwise.
